Based on the book The Fox and Overshoes by Liudvikas Jakimavičius
Director: Agnė Sunklodaitė
Set and costume designer: Ramunė Skrebūnaitė
Composer: Deividas Gnedinas
Actors: Saulius Čiučelis, Artūras Sužiedėlis, Henrikas Savickis, Inga Mikutavičiūtė, Ridas Žirgulis, Ugnė Žirgulė
Duration – 1 hour
A funny and playful play presents a very serious topic – emigration and love for the homeland. The hare Bernadetas, a small businessman, decides to emigrate from his home forest to Vilnius. On his way, he meets friends with the same fate, emigrants from the Petruška farm: the pig Kleopatra, the dog Cezaris and the goat Makedonas. How was their journey? Did they find the city of dreams friendly? You will find all the answers if you come to watch the play. It can be perceived both as a playful and funny fairy tale for kids and a grotesque parabola of modern times for adults. The play perfectly fits various tastes. Actors not only act on the stage but also communicate with the audience, ask to join the play and at the same time personify various characters and sing on the stage.
